>   Inquiring minds want to know! I'm not saying "I don't believe it,
> prove it!" ... merely curious. I too have come across a number of
> inefficiencies but most of them had fairly simple work-arounds once
> the problem area was identified.

  With a statement like *that*, I feel *I* have to be more specific.
:-) By inefficiencies, I mean that most of them were design problems
with my model or "angle of approach" to getting to the data I'm
interested in. One was specifically due to a Core Data limitation
(compound ANY/NOT ANY/NONE predicates with a SQLite store), but it
turns out the feature that necessitated that particular predicate was
a "gee-whiz" feature that wasn't really needed anyway, so dropping it
entirely made that problem go away completely. ;-)
